| OLD | NEW | 
|---|
| 1 // Copyright (c) 2013, the Dart project authors.  Please see the AUTHORS file | 1 // Copyright (c) 2013, the Dart project authors.  Please see the AUTHORS file | 
| 2 // for details. All rights reserved. Use of this source code is governed by a | 2 // for details. All rights reserved. Use of this source code is governed by a | 
| 3 // BSD-style license that can be found in the LICENSE file. | 3 // BSD-style license that can be found in the LICENSE file. | 
| 4 | 4 | 
| 5 import "package:expect/expect.dart"; | 5 import "package:expect/expect.dart"; | 
| 6 import "dart:async"; | 6 import "dart:async"; | 
| 7 import "dart:io"; | 7 import "dart:io"; | 
| 8 import "dart:isolate"; | 8 import "dart:isolate"; | 
| 9 | 9 | 
| 10 const HOST_NAME = "localhost"; | 10 const HOST_NAME = "localhost"; | 
| (...skipping 92 matching lines...) Expand 10 before | Expand all | Expand 10 after  Loading... | 
| 103       clientDone.then((_) { | 103       clientDone.then((_) { | 
| 104         Expect.isTrue(clientError); | 104         Expect.isTrue(clientError); | 
| 105         server.close(); | 105         server.close(); | 
| 106         port.close(); | 106         port.close(); | 
| 107       }); | 107       }); | 
| 108     }); | 108     }); | 
| 109   }); | 109   }); | 
| 110 } | 110 } | 
| 111 | 111 | 
| 112 void main() { | 112 void main() { | 
| 113   Path scriptDir = new Path(new Options().script).directoryPath; | 113   Path scriptDir = new Path(Platform.script).directoryPath; | 
| 114   Path certificateDatabase = scriptDir.append('pkcert'); | 114   Path certificateDatabase = scriptDir.append('pkcert'); | 
| 115   SecureSocket.initialize(database: certificateDatabase.toNativePath(), | 115   SecureSocket.initialize(database: certificateDatabase.toNativePath(), | 
| 116                           password: 'dartdart', | 116                           password: 'dartdart', | 
| 117                           useBuiltinRoots: false); | 117                           useBuiltinRoots: false); | 
| 118 | 118 | 
| 119   testClientCertificate(); | 119   testClientCertificate(); | 
| 120   testRequiredClientCertificate(); | 120   testRequiredClientCertificate(); | 
| 121   testNoClientCertificate(); | 121   testNoClientCertificate(); | 
| 122   testNoRequiredClientCertificate(); | 122   testNoRequiredClientCertificate(); | 
| 123 } | 123 } | 
| OLD | NEW | 
|---|